开源淘宝客微信小程序前后台源码解析
下载需积分: 5 | ZIP格式 | 30.6MB |
更新于2024-12-02
| 79 浏览量 | 举报
知识点:
1. 微信小程序概念与结构:
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。它具有运行速度快、使用便捷、易推广等优点。微信小程序主要包括前端和后端两部分,前端主要用到的技术文件有app.js、app.json、app.wxss、pages目录下的页面文件以及wxParse这样的富文本解析组件等。
2. 微信小程序前端文件详解:
- app.js: 是小程序的逻辑文件,用于定义全局变量、小程序的生命周期函数等,是小程序的入口文件之一。
- app.json: 是小程序的全局配置文件,用于设置小程序的页面路径、窗口表现、设置网络超时时间、设置多tab等。
- app.wxss: 是小程序的全局样式表文件,用于定义全局的CSS样式,适用于整个小程序。
- pages: 这个目录通常包含多个页面文件夹,每个页面文件夹中通常包含四个文件:js(页面逻辑)、json(当前页面的配置)、wxml(页面结构)、wxss(页面样式表)。
- wxParse: 是微信小程序富文本解析插件,支持 HTML 解析并支持自定义标签、样式等,常用于展示商品详情、文章内容等场景。
3. 微信小程序后端文件与概念:
- TBKAdmin.zip: 表示该开源版包含了淘宝客后台源码的压缩包。淘宝客是一种按成交付费的推广模式,也称为联盟营销。淘宝客通过推广淘宝商品来赚取佣金,这种模式同样适用于微信小程序平台。
- utils: 通常用于存放小程序的工具函数,比如日期格式化、请求封装等,方便在多个页面或组件中复用。
4. 微信小程序开发环境与工具:
- project.config.json: 这是微信小程序项目的配置文件,包含了项目的一些基本信息,比如项目id、项目名称、项目版本等,这个文件通常与开发者工具配合使用,开发者工具能够根据这个文件识别项目并进行相应的配置。
5. 微信小程序的应用场景与运营:
淘宝客微信小程序是将传统的淘宝客营销模式与微信小程序平台相结合的产物。用户在微信中即可搜索并使用小程序浏览商品、加入购物车、下单购买,并通过分享给微信好友等方式获得佣金,有助于扩大淘宝客的推广范围和提升用户体验。
6. 开源软件的使用与合规性:
该资源为“开源版”,意味着源码可以被公开获取和使用,但开源软件的使用也需要注意遵守其许可协议。开源协议规定了使用者可以在什么条件下使用源码、修改源码以及重新分发源码。因此,在使用此资源之前,开发者应当仔细阅读开源协议,确保合法合规地使用。
综上所述,提供的资源包含了微信小程序的完整前后端源码,涵盖前端页面结构与样式、后端淘宝客管理系统以及相关的开发工具和配置文件。开发者可以利用这些资源构建自己的淘宝客小程序,同时要确保遵循相应的开源协议和开发规范。
相关推荐
晓枫-迷麟
- 粉丝: 129
最新资源
- Windows环境下Oracle RAC集群安装步骤详解
- PSP编程入门:Lua教程详解
- GDI+ SDK详解:罕见的技术文档
- LoadRunner基础教程:企业级压力测试详解
- Crystal Reports 7:增强交叉表功能教程与设计技巧
- 软件开发文档编写指南:从需求分析到经济评估
- Delphi 使用ShellExecute API详解
- Crystal Reports 6.x 的交叉表功能与限制解析
- 掌握Linux:60个核心命令详解
- Oracle PL/SQL 存储过程详解及应用
- Linux 2.6内核基础配置详解与关键选项
- 软件工程需求与模型选择:原型化与限制
- 掌握GCC链接器ld:中文翻译与实用指南
- Ubuntu 8.04 安装与入门指南:新手快速上手必备
- 面向服务架构(SOA)与Web服务入门
- 详解Linux下GNUMake编译工具使用指南